What happens when mobile networks or the Internet are unavailable?

In this morning workshop at RoseLab, participants will explore how decentralized devices can exchange messages and location information without relying on public network infrastructure. The session combines an introduction to mesh networking with a practical hardware customization workflow using CodeCraft, Seeed Studio’s browser-based AI coding assistant for hardware.

Instead of beginning with a complex local development environment, participants can describe the intended hardware behavior, generate a first implementation, deploy it to the device, observe the result, and refine it.

What Participants Will Explore

The exact activities differ between the robotics and mesh sessions, but all three workshops share a practical approach:

  1. Start with a real hardware goal.
  2. Describe the intended behavior clearly.
  3. Generate or configure a first working version.
  4. Deploy it to physical hardware.
  5. Observe, test, and improve the result.

The workshops are demonstrations of practical development workflows, not promises that every project will work without testing. Hardware behavior, network conditions, device configuration, and generated code still need to be reviewed during the build process.
